A Billion Pound Road Closure in UK

featured image
25 May 2015
By admin
Road Closed

England had 500k+ road closures which cost the country estimated one billion pounds last year   The UK road safety chief has called for action after more than 500k road closures in 2014 which cost them more than one billion pounds. The report shows that wild animals, unsupervised and unattended children, wandering pedestrians and road […]